Same-Day Repair of Recto-Vaginal Fistula Using the Robotic Trans-Anal Minimally Invasive Technique How We Do It

Summary
Robotic transanal minimally invasive surgery (R-TAMIS) offers a feasible approach for rectovaginal fistula repair. This robotic technique shows promise for reducing morbidity and improving outcomes compared to traditional methods.
Area of Science:
- Minimally Invasive Surgery
- Surgical Robotics
- Gastroenterology
Background:
- Traditional open rectovaginal fistula (RVF) repair methods have high recurrence and morbidity rates.
- Robotic-assisted surgery offers improved visualization and precision, potentially reducing complications.
- Robotic transanal minimally invasive surgery (R-TAMIS) presents a novel transanal approach for RVF repair.
Purpose of the Study:
- To evaluate the feasibility and effectiveness of the R-TAMIS technique for benign RVF repair.
- To assess the safety and outcomes of robotic-assisted transanal repair for RVF.
Main Methods:
- R-TAMIS using the da Vinci Xi® system for same-day RVF repair.
- Transanal access via GelPOINT Path, robotic port placement, and fistula tract dissection.
- Vaginal and rectal wall closure using barbed sutures, fibrin sealant, and acellular dermal mesh.
Main Results:
- The R-TAMIS procedure was well-tolerated with same-day discharge and minimal pain.
- No major immediate postoperative complications were observed.
- Enhanced visualization and dexterity facilitated precise surgical maneuvers.
Conclusions:
- R-TAMIS is a feasible and effective minimally invasive option for selected benign RVF patients.
- This robotic approach may offer reduced morbidity and improved outcomes over open or laparoscopic methods.
- Proper patient selection and surgical technique are crucial for successful R-TAMIS outcomes.
